What You Will Do :

  • Assist management in planning, development, implementation and evaluation activities of Talent Assessment and Talent Development
  • Responsible for managing several key areas within the HR function, such as talent development, inclusion, talent acquisition, employee relations, compensation, training and development, safety, disability and worker’s compensation
  • Drive key Human Resources initiatives and strategic processes within Supply Chain
  • Foster employee engagement through proactive employee relations and performance management
  • Partner with leadership to set the strategy to acquire, develop and retain talent and lead succession planning for key roles
  • Lead initiatives on talent development for Managers and first level supervisors to include facilitation of training
  • Coach supervisors for effective leadership and change management as well as standard progressive counseling and managing employee development issues
  • Partner with other members of the leadership team to support training and development for associates
  • Oversee the management of the talent selection process and develop process improvements. Manage temporary agency relationships to ensure high quality applicants
  • Ensure consistent, fair and legally compliant employment practices; conduct workplace investigations
  • Partner with Safety Leaders to manage workers compensation cases
  • Manage the short-term disability program partnering with the Canadian Benefits team and the occupational health provider
  • Represent the company in the community for the purpose of networking, identifying human resources best practices and improving Ecolab’s standing within the community
